CryptoComLearn says roughly 20% of the existing 18.5 million Bitcoin is considered lost, permanently inaccessible, or held in blocked wallets. In many cases, the coins are still on-chain. What users lose is access: an old wallet file, a private key, a password hint, or the seed phrase needed to rebuild the wallet.
The guide starts with the obvious place people often forget to check: old hardware. That includes computers, internal drives, external hard drives, USB sticks, and even CDs or DVDs. Bitcoin is not stored as loose files in the way many people imagine. Access depends on wallet software and the credentials tied to it, especially private keys, public keys, and the wallet.dat file. If the private key is gone for good, the BTC tied to that wallet may be unreachable as well.
Search the device first, then look for written clues
The article points users to wallet.dat as a primary target. On Windows, it recommends searching the system for “wallet.dat” and checking whether software named Bitcoin was installed. It also lists common directory paths for Windows XP, Windows Vista, and Windows 7. On macOS, the suggested location is ~/Library/Application Support/Bitcoin/wallet.dat, with instructions to reveal the hidden Library folder and inspect it manually.
The search should not stop there. Old text documents may contain useful traces, including files named Bitcoin, wallet, key, password, BTC, or pass. Some users stored private keys, notes, or even a recovery phrase in plain text. A forgotten document can matter as much as the wallet file itself.
Seed phrases and private keys are the real recovery layer
The guide explains that a seed phrase, also called a recovery phrase, usually contains 12 to 24 words and can regenerate a wallet. It gives examples: Electrum commonly uses 12-word seed phrases, while Trezor uses 24-word phrases. If a compatible wallet is available, entering that phrase can restore control over the funds.
If the seed phrase is missing, a private key may still be enough. The article mentions wallets such as Electrum for private-key-based recovery. It also notes that a preserved wallet.dat file can serve as another path back into an older wallet. The principle is simple: whoever still controls the valid key material controls the BTC linked to those addresses.
Recovery tools may help if files were deleted
For users who cannot locate the wallet data, the guide lists several file recovery tools: Recuva and Puran File Recovery for Windows, and TestDisk for macOS. These tools are meant to recover deleted or misplaced files from hard drives, external media, CDs, and DVDs. They do not bypass wallet security. Their value depends on whether the original data can still be recovered from storage.
The article also mentions professional recovery services that may ask for partial wallet details, such as a public key or seed phrase information. It adds a clear caveat: such services can be expensive, and success is not guaranteed.
Check the address on-chain before assuming funds remain
Once a wallet address has been found, the guide suggests verifying activity and balance through Blockchain.com. By entering the address, users can review transaction count, BTC sent and received, and the current balance. That step matters. Finding an old wallet artifact does not automatically mean coins are still there.
The guide keeps its message practical. Lost access does not always mean lost Bitcoin, but recovery depends on whether the user still has the seed phrase, private key, or wallet file. If those elements have disappeared completely, the BTC may remain visible on-chain and still be impossible to move.
